Beyond Korean Style
Shaping a New Growth Formula
Publisher Description
South Korea remains a global case study for economic development. Known as the "Miracle on the Han," South Korea's record-breaking industrialization turned it from one of the world's poorest states to a global economic power. However, its growth formula is no longer working. In this report, the McKinsey Global Institute focuses on the causes of stresses on middle-income Korean households and how their financial crunch is affecting the overall economy. It then examines the elements needed in a new growth model for Korea.
